Output 38b5efcd7deb925e62a90c915892d63887e0e48c55913061580fa0080065fa41:0

value
19316
script pubkey
OP_0 OP_PUSHBYTES_20 fe6de92dfde99a7c1ac61655a12c4d124cc9409a
address
bc1qlek7jt0aaxd8cxkxze26ztzdzfxvjsy625xh7n
transaction
38b5efcd7deb925e62a90c915892d63887e0e48c55913061580fa0080065fa41
confirmations
153433
spent
true